2026/2/11 10:43:21
网站建设
项目流程
千元低价网站建设,wordpress 主题不居中,做视频网站 投入,网站后台jsp怎么做分页快速体验
打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容#xff1a;
生成一个企业级NGINX集群部署方案#xff0c;包含#xff1a;1. 3节点NGINX负载均衡配置 2. 后端服务器健康检查设置 3. Keepalived实现VIP故障转移 4. 日志集中收集方案 5. 性能…快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容生成一个企业级NGINX集群部署方案包含1. 3节点NGINX负载均衡配置 2. 后端服务器健康检查设置 3. Keepalived实现VIP故障转移 4. 日志集中收集方案 5. 性能监控指标配置。要求提供完整的配置文件模板和部署流程图。点击项目生成按钮等待项目生成完整后预览效果企业级NGINX集群部署实战从安装到高可用最近在帮公司搭建新的Web服务架构需要部署一套高可用的NGINX集群。经过几轮测试和优化总结出一套比较成熟的企业级方案分享给大家参考。1. 3节点NGINX负载均衡配置首先需要准备3台服务器作为负载均衡节点。建议选择相同配置的机器避免性能不均衡。安装NGINX后主要配置集中在负载均衡策略上采用加权轮询算法可以根据后端服务器性能分配不同权重设置连接超时为3秒避免慢请求堆积启用HTTP长连接减少TCP握手开销配置缓冲区大小优化大文件传输性能关键是要确保upstream配置正确将流量均匀分发到后端应用服务器。我们测试发现合理的超时设置能显著提高系统稳定性。2. 后端服务器健康检查健康检查是保证服务可用的关键环节。我们实现了两种检查方式被动检查NGINX自动检测后端响应状态标记故障节点主动检查通过第三方模块定期发送探测请求建议设置较短的检查间隔如5秒但要注意不要给后端造成太大压力。当检测到故障时NGINX会自动将流量切换到健康节点并在节点恢复后重新加入集群。3. Keepalived实现VIP故障转移为了消除单点故障我们使用Keepalived实现虚拟IPVIP的自动漂移主备节点通过VRRP协议通信主节点定期发送心跳包备用节点在超时后自动接管VIP支持多备份节点形成故障转移链配置时要注意调整心跳间隔和优先级参数确保故障切换时间控制在秒级。我们实测切换时间平均在2秒左右对用户体验影响很小。4. 日志集中收集方案生产环境需要完善的日志系统来排查问题。我们采用ELK方案每台NGINX配置JSON格式日志Filebeat收集日志并发送到LogstashLogstash进行日志过滤和格式化Elasticsearch存储和索引日志数据Kibana提供可视化查询界面这样可以从一个控制台查看所有节点的访问日志、错误日志还能设置告警规则。5. 性能监控指标配置监控是运维的眼睛我们配置了多维度监控NGINX状态模块提供基础指标Prometheus收集QPS、响应时间等数据Grafana展示监控仪表盘设置关键指标告警阈值特别要关注连接数、请求处理时间和5xx错误率这些能第一时间反映系统健康状态。部署心得整个部署过程在InsCode(快马)平台上测试非常方便。平台提供的一键部署功能让我能快速验证配置效果不用自己搭建复杂的环境。特别是测试负载均衡策略时可以即时看到修改后的效果大大提高了调试效率。对于企业级应用来说高可用架构是必须的。这套方案经过我们生产环境验证能承受日均百万级请求量。关键是要根据实际业务特点调整参数并做好充分的压力测试。快速体验打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容生成一个企业级NGINX集群部署方案包含1. 3节点NGINX负载均衡配置 2. 后端服务器健康检查设置 3. Keepalived实现VIP故障转移 4. 日志集中收集方案 5. 性能监控指标配置。要求提供完整的配置文件模板和部署流程图。点击项目生成按钮等待项目生成完整后预览效果